Pre-Operation Safety Checks
Before operating any mobile cement mixer for sale, conduct safety checks. Inspect the mixer for visible damage or wear. Check the tires, brakes, and lights for proper function.
Ensure the engine oil and coolant levels are adequate. Low levels can cause engine damage or overheating. Verify all safety guards and covers are in place.
Check the drum for any obstructions or residue. A clean drum ensures proper mixing and prevents contamination. Confirm all controls and gauges are functioning correctly.
Review the operator’s manual for specific safety guidelines. Each mixer model may have unique requirements. Understanding these details helps prevent misuse.
Safe Setup and Positioning
Position the mobile concrete mixer on stable, level ground. Uneven surfaces can cause tipping or instability. Ensure the area has enough space for safe operation and movement.
For self-loading mixer concrete, ensure the loading area is clear. Remove any obstacles that could interfere with the loading process. This prevents accidents and material spills.
Place the mixer close to the work area. Minimize the distance for transporting concrete. This reduces handling time and maintains concrete quality.
Secure the mixer properly before operation. Use wheel chocks if on a slope. This prevents accidental movement during operation.

Efficient Operation Techniques
Start the engine and let it warm up before mixing. This ensures smooth operation and prevents engine strain. Follow the manufacturer’s recommended warm-up procedures.
Load materials in the correct order and proportions. For self-loading mixers, ensure the correct settings for material intake. Proper loading ensures consistent concrete quality.
Monitor the mixing process closely. Adjust speed and settings as needed. Consistent mixing produces high-quality concrete for your project.
Keep the mixing area clean and organized. Remove spilled materials promptly. This prevents accidents and maintains a safe work environment.
Maintenance and Care
Regular maintenance extends the mixer’s lifespan. Clean the drum and mixing blades after each use. This prevents material buildup and ensures efficient mixing.
Inspect and replace worn parts promptly. Worn blades or belts can affect mixing quality. Regular inspections prevent unexpected breakdowns.
Check and tighten all bolts and connections. Loose parts can cause vibrations or malfunctions. Secure connections ensure safe operation.
Store the mixer properly when not in use. Cover it to protect from weather elements. Proper storage maintains the mixer’s condition and readiness.
Training and Operator Responsibility
Proper training is essential for safe operation. Ensure all operators understand the mixer’s controls and safety features. Training reduces the risk of accidents and misuse.
Operators should wear appropriate safety gear. Helmets, gloves, and safety boots protect against injuries. Safety gear is a must for all mixing tasks.
Encourage operators to follow all safety guidelines. Consistent adherence to procedures ensures a safe work environment. Safety is everyone’s responsibility on the job site.
